獲取本機網絡卡IP及對應的mac

#include <stdio.h>
#include <stdlib.h>
#include <sys/ioctl.h>
#include <sys/types.h>
#include <sys/socket.h>
#include <unistd.h>
#include <string.h>
#include <net/if.h>
#include <net/if_arp.h>
#include <arpa/inet.h>
#include <errno.h>
typedef long LONG;
typedef char CHAR;
#define CONST const
#ifndef SUCCESS
#define SUCCESS 0
#endif
#ifndef FAIL
#define FAIL -1
#endif
LONG GetMac(CONST CHAR *pcIfName, CHAR *pcMac)
{
if (NULL == pcIfName || NULL == pcMac)
{
printf("NULL == pcIfName || NULL == pcMac\n");
return FAIL;
}
LONG lFd = 0, lRet = FAIL;
struct ifreq ifr;
memset(&ifr, 0, sizeof(ifr));
strcpy(ifr.ifr_name, pcIfName);
lFd = socket(AF_INET, SOCK_STREAM, 0);
if(lFd < 0)
{
printf("socket fail\n");
return FAIL;
}
//lRet = ioctl(lFd, SIOCGIFHWADDR, &ifr, sizeof(ifr));
lRet = ioctl(lFd, SIOCGIFHWADDR, &ifr);
if(0 == lRet)
{
memcpy(pcMac, ifr.ifr_hwaddr.sa_data, 6);
printf("\nifr.ifr_hwaddr.sa_data is %s \n",ifr.ifr_hwaddr.sa_data);
close(lFd);
return SUCCESS;
}
else
{
printf("ioctl fail\n");
close(lFd);
return FAIL;
}
}
LONG GetIp(CONST CHAR *pcIfName, CHAR *pcIp)
{
if (NULL == pcIfName || NULL == pcIp)
{
printf("NULL == pcIfName || NULL == pcIp\n");
return FAIL;
}
LONG lFd = 0, lRet = FAIL;
struct ifreq ifr;
memset(&ifr, 0, sizeof(ifr));
strcpy(ifr.ifr_name, pcIfName);
lFd = socket(AF_INET, SOCK_STREAM, 0);
if(lFd < 0)
{
printf("socket fail\n");
return FAIL;
}
lRet = ioctl(lFd, SIOCGIFADDR, &ifr);
if(0 == lRet)
{
strncpy(pcIp,inet_ntoa(((struct sockaddr_in*)&(ifr.ifr_addr))->sin_addr),16);
close(lFd);
return SUCCESS;
}
else
{
printf("ioctl fail\n");
close(lFd);
return FAIL;
}
}
int main()
{
LONG lRet = FAIL;
CHAR szMac[6] = {0};
CHAR szIp[16] = {0};
CHAR szID[21] = {0};
int i=0;
int ulLen = 0;
lRet = GetMac("eth0", szMac);
for(i = 0; i < sizeof(szMac); i++)
{
sprintf(szID + strlen((const char*)szID), "%02X", szMac[i]);
ulLen = snprintf(szID, 1024, "%02X", szMac[i]);
ulLen +=snprintf((szID + ulLen), 1024, "%02X", szMac[i]);
printf("%0x,",szMac[i]);
}
printf("\nlRet is %lu,mac is %s\n",lRet,szID);
lRet = GetIp("eth0", szIp);
printf("lRet is %lu,szIp is %s\n",lRet,szIp);
return 0;
}
